However this compass from Ozark Trails proved to be handy in a trial I gave it a few weeks ago in New Mexico. I placed myself in a remote mesa at the foot of a trail leading up to the Manzano Mountains. I then followed the instructions on the package of the Ozark Trail compass.

It says to: Place the compass on map with edge along the desired line of travel(These are illustrated on the reverse of the package) Rotate the capsule until the 'N' on the compass dial points to magnetic North on the map...pick up the compass and turn your body until the red end of the needle points to North on the compass dial."

I did so and found this task easy to accomplish.

"...The "direction of travel" arrow in the base now points precisely to your direction. Choose a landmark or spot . Choose a landmark or a spot in this direction. Walk to the landmark without looking at the compass and repeat the procedure until you reach your destination"

It all sounds a bit complicated but if you pull out a map and practice with this compass you will get a good understanding of how it works.
